Each plastic material has unique advantages, that can be better served by different applications. A comparison of the relevant characteristics to select the best materials for your needs, most efficiently.
PA Nylon Conduit offers excellent mechanical strength and superior heat resistance. Nylon Conduit is used in dynamic applications like robotics or other automotive applications where parts are constantly in motion. PA Nylon is oil, fuel and many industrial chemical resistant. PA Nylon Conduit can withstand high frequency bending and perform reliably in applications where it will be exposed to lubricants and solvents.
PE conduits have excellent flexibility and impact resistance at low temperatures, therefore they are very suitable for general-purpose cable protection. The conduits are light-weight and easy to bend for installation in small spaces such as control cabinets or wiring ducts in houses. PE conduits have moderate chemical resistance and are therefore preferably used in locations where only limited chemical exposure can occur. PP conduits have better chemical resistance.
Flexible PP plastic conduits are highly resistant to acids, alkalis, and to a wide range of organic solvents. They are thus ideal for use in areas where high levels of corrosion are present, such as chemical processing plants, or in wastewater treatment facilities. PP retains its rigidity within moderate temperature ranges, and is also capable of providing long-term stable performance when in contact with harsh media.

Selecting the right material for your products depends on matching some of the key properties of materials with your company’s operational requirements in different markets.
PA Nylon is used for cables in industrial automation where the cables are moving or subject to mechanical stress all the time. PA Nylon is very wear resistant and less prone to permanent deformation. Thus PA Nylon is ideal for applications like robotic arms and machine tools where many bending cycles are performed.
For outdoor electrical systems exposed to sunlight or cold climates, PE conduits deliver dependable performance thanks to their flexibility at low temperatures and UV-resistant formulations when stabilized properly. They are widely applied in renewable energy installations such as solar power plants where durability against environmental stress is crucial.
PP conduits are unmatched when it comes to chemical resistance to aggressive substances typical for chemical production sites. The stable structure of PP conduits is not affected by acid vapors as well as by aggressive liquids, thus extending the service life of the conduits and at the same time ensuring constant electrical safety.
Just as important as choosing the correct conduit material, installing it correctly is vital to the overall reliability of the system. By following established guidelines for the proper installation of conduit, it will be optimally protected throughout its product life.
Before you start to assemble check that the conduit sizes for the cables and for the fittings are correct. Cut the conduits cleanly so that there are no sharp edges to damage the insulation of the cables when they are pushed into the conduit or later in operation. It is important to note that it is recommended to bend cables within the manufacturer’s recommended bending radius to avoid placing stress on the cables that could cause fatigue of the conductors or cracking of the insulation. In addition, it is important to ensure that fittings are used to hold connections together securely and to seal the area around the fitting to prevent entry of dust or moisture. For IP rated cables this is particularly important for use in outdoor locations or near water as damage to the insulation could result in a reduction in rating.
